Juicer’s First Ads From Gearon Hoffman Play Up All-Natural Angle
BOSTON–Gearon Hoffman’s initial branding work for Apple & Eve’s all-natural juices plays like a cross between Chiffon margarine’s 70’s-era “Mother Nature” ads and Alfred Hitchcock’s The Birds.
A 30-second TV spot features a woman in a flowing dress who plays with birds in a lush garden. Her feathered friends quickly morph into kids, their sweet song dissolving into shrill cries of “Mom! Mom!” as the youngsters demand juice.
The execution goes on to name competitor Ocean Spray Cranberries, a voiceover noting that Apple & Eve’s cranberry blend is 100 percent juice while Ocean Spray Cranberry Juice Cocktail contains 27 percent.
